Some Like it Hot

Some Like it Hot ‘Some like it Hot’ (Wilder 1959) - Film is set in 1929 (Time of the stock market crash) - Different social groups are represented, gender and femininity - Boot legging (Illegal alcohol selling) and gangs in background - speak easies Civil rights movements happening around that time Social norms and values of the says dictated the films genre and tone The comedic aspects are built around the theme identity, disguise and cross-dressing had to use humour as a vehicle for the more progressive, taboo and controversial themes as the centre (Hays code) One device in this vein is to situate the plot and events back to the 1920s.
